Evidence for resonant structures in e+e- to pi+pi-h_c

Abstract

The cross sections of e+e- to pi+pi-h_c at center-of-mass energies from 3.90 to 4.42 GeV were measured by the BESIII and the CLEO-c experiments. Resonant structures are evident in the e+e- to pi+pi-h_c line shape, the fit to the line shape results in a narrow structure at a mass of (4216\pm 18) MeV/c^2 and a width of (39\pm 32) MeV, and a possible wide structure of mass (4293\pm 9) MeV/c^2 and width (222\pm 67) MeV. Here the errors are combined statistical and systematic errors. This may indicate that the Y(4260) state observed in e+e- to pi+pi-J/psi has fine structure in it.
